Understanding the Implications of the US Digital Rights Crackdown

In a significant escalation, the Trump administration has intensified its efforts against digital rights, recently banning five individuals from entering the US, including Josephine Ballon from the nonprofit HateAid, which supports victims of online harassment. This development raises vital questions regarding the intersection of government action, digital rights, and free speech.

Josephine Ballon argues that the organization's mission includes fostering safer online environments and combating misinformation, directly countering accusations by politicians that HeyAid engages in censorship. Notably, EU officials and various freedom of speech advocates echo this sentiment, indicating a pronounced division between differing viewpoints on online safety and censorship.

AI Companionship: A Growing Trend with Complex Implications

The integration of artificial intelligence in everyday life is perhaps most evident in the surge of AI companions or chatbots, which offer emotional support and companionship. A study by Common Sense Media reveals that 72% of US teenagers have engaged with AI for companionship, signaling a growing reliance on technology for social interaction.

While these chatbots can provide comfort and support, experts caution about their potential negative impact, especially on vulnerable populations. AI companions can inadvertently exacerbate mental health issues or create dependencies that hinder real-life connections. Regulatory agencies such as the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) have initiated inquiries to understand how companies are addressing potential risks, particularly those posed to children and teens, emphasizing the need for responsible development and usage of chatbot technology.

Virtual Power Plants: An Innovative Solution for Data Centers Amid the growing energy demands of data centers, virtual power plants (VPPs) offer a potential solution. These systems aggregate resources, such as electric vehicles and smart appliances, to stabilize electricity grids, especially during peak usage times. Recently, Google has invested in a VPP project that facilitates payment for customers willing to reduce their energy consumption, particularly to support local data centers. The effectiveness of this model hinges on consumer participation. If customers are not willing to adjust their electrical usage, the project may not yield expected results. However, as energy prices soar, this initiative may provide an attractive financial incentive for businesses and consumers alike. This evolving trend not only highlights the growing intersection between technology and energy management but also raises questions about widespread adoption and infrastructure adequacy. How Virtual Power Plants Are Revolutionizing Energy for Data Centers

Update The Rise of Virtual Power Plants in Data Center Energy Solutions In recent years, technology giants have been grappling with escalating energy demands, particularly as they expand their data center operations. Among the innovative solutions emerging is the concept of virtual power plants (VPPs), which offer a flexible means of managing electrical loads during peak times. A notable agreement struck between Google and Voltus to establish a VPP marks a significant step towards integrating renewable energy sources and distributed grid resources to support data center operations. Understanding Virtual Power Plants and Their Benefits Virtual power plants aggregate distributed energy resources (DERs), such as electric vehicles, smart appliances, and stored energy, to provide grid stability. By allowing users to participate in demand response programs, VPPs can reduce electrical consumption when the grid experiences stress. For businesses like Google, this means having a reliable source of energy for their data centers while also benefitting from financial incentives. Voltus's 'Bring Your Own Capacity' (BYOC) program exemplifies how organizations can leverage existing loads rather than waiting for new infrastructure to be built. The Importance of Flexibility for Data Centers As data centers consume a significant amount of energy, finding ways to operate efficiently without relying solely on conventional power sources is vital. Recent studies indicate that by curtailing power demand for only a fraction of the year, data centers can significantly ease the burden on the grid. A study from Duke University highlighted that reducing energy demand for 40 hours annually could provide substantial capacity without necessitating new generation plants. This demonstrates the potential for VPPs to play a crucial role in energy management. Incentives and Regulations Driving Participation However, encouraging data centers to participate in these flexible energy programs is not without challenges. Some facilities may fear that reducing their energy load could lead to operational inefficiencies and lost revenue, particularly in an era where immediate customer demand is high. Regulatory frameworks can help incentivize participation; proposed regulations suggest that data centers might gain quicker access to the grid if they commit to reducing their energy demand during peak periods. Impact of the Growing Data Center Market The demand for data centers is expected to balloon, leading to mounting pressure on the already strained U.S. grid systems. Voltus’s innovative approach not only helps data center operators manage their energy demands but also aids in alleviating the burden on utilities and the infrastructure costs associated with massive power requirements. As they navigate the challenges of connecting new data centers to the grid, leveraging VPPs proves not only economically viable but also socially responsible.
